Eaglemount Wine and Cider is an award-winning artisan winery and cidery on Washington's Olympic Peninsula, founded in 2006 on the old Homestead Farm in Eaglemount. They produce wines from grape harvest and hard ciders, with a focus on small-batch quality. The business has expanded to a new property at the edge of Port Townsend featuring the Palindrome event center and future vineyard/orchard.
